Helmsley Trust Funds Diabetes Information Exchange Project

The Jaeb Center will build an information exchange for type 1 diabetics patients, their clinicians and researchers funded by a $26 million grant from the Helmsley Charitable Trust.

The Leona M. and Harry B. Helmsley Charitable Trust has awarded a $26 million grant to Jaeb Center for the creation of a Type 1 diabetes information exchange. Jaeb Center, based in Tampa, is a freestanding non-profit coordinating center for multi-center clinical trials and epidemiology research projects primarily involving eye disorders or diabetes.
